A Design Asset Built for Real-World Application
What truly sets this package apart is its practicality. You're not just getting a single file; you're getting a toolkit. The included EPS and AI vector files are the workhorses for any professional designer. They allow for infinite scaling without loss of quality, perfect for large-format printing on banners or detailed work on tiny labels. The SVG file is the darling of the web and modern digital design, ensuring crisp rendering on screens of all resolutions. The high-resolution PNG with a transparent background is the ultimate convenience asset—ready to drag and drop into mockups, social media templates, or design software without any background removal hassle.

Making Smart Design Choices with This Asset
Integrating a premium font or graphic like this requires a bit of strategic thinking. Here’s how to ensure it works for you, not against you.
Evaluate the Project Fit: This design has a strong personality. It's perfect for projects aiming for a tone that is playful, humorous, relatable, and modern. It might not be the best fit for ultra-serious corporate communications or minimalist, austere branding. Always consider your audience. This graphic speaks directly to a demographic that appreciates internet culture, pets, and lighthearted fun.
Mastering Font Pairing and Composition: The "Are You Kitten Me Right Meow" graphic is a display font or illustration at heart. It's meant to be the star. If you need to pair it with other text, choose a supporting typeface that doesn't compete. A clean, simple sans serif font or a neutral serif font for body copy will let the main graphic shine. Think of it as the headline act with a reliable backing band. In editorial design or on a web design layout, use it for pull quotes, section headers, or hero imagery to inject personality without overwhelming the page.
Consider Readability and Context: In most of its intended applications—merchandise, graphics, decorative items—absolute typographic readability is secondary to impact and charm. However, if you're using a portion of the text within a longer sentence, ensure the chosen style is clear at the intended size. Test it. Print a sample or view it on multiple devices. The beauty of having the vector files is that you can easily adjust scale, color, or even isolate elements to fit your specific context.
